⑴ web前端和web后端的区别有哪些
1、展示方式
前端是用户可见的界面,网站前端页面也就是网页的页面开发,比如网页上的特效、布局、图片、视频,音频等内容。前端的工作内容就是将美工设计的效果图的设计成浏览器可以运行的网页,并配合后端做网页的数据显示和交互等可视方面的工作内容。
后端用户看不见的东西,通常是与前端工程师进行数据交互及网站数据的保存和读取,相对来说后端涉及到的逻辑代码比前端要多得多,后端考虑的是底层业务逻辑的实现,平台的稳定性与性能等。
2、技术实现
前端开发用到的技术包括但不限于html5、css3、javascript、jquery、Bootstrap、Node.js 、Webpack,AngularJs,ReactJs,VueJs等技术;后端开发以java为例主要用到的是包括但不限于Struts spring springmvc Hibernate Http协议 Servlet Tomcat服务器等技术。
3、工作内容
前端工程师负责Web前端开发、移动端开发、大数据呈现端开发。Web前端开发针对PC端开发任务;移动端开发包括Android开发、iOS开发和各种小程序开发,在移动互联网迅速发展的带动下,移动端的开发任务量是比较大的;大数据呈现则主要是基于已有的平台完成最终分析结果的呈现,呈现方式通常也有多种选择。
后端工程师负责平台设计、接口设计和功能实现。平台设计主要是搭建后端的支撑服务容器;接口设计主要针对于不同行业进行相应的功能接口设计,通常一个平台有多套接口,就像卫星导航平台设有民用和军用两套接口一样;功能实现则是完成具体的业务逻辑实现。
⑵ 先学Linux运维还是web前端
同学你好,事实上web前端和Linux运维差别还是挺大的。
毫无疑问,两个发展方向前景和需求都是非常不错的。
Web前端是一个学习门槛低,范围广泛,技术更新迭代迅速的领域,远远不止是写页面这么简单。如果你想要做好一个网站的视觉效果和交互效果,那么请深挖前端。
当然,如果你只是让你的页面写的好看一点,而又想学习Linux运维的话,可以考虑浅度学习浅度前端的基本知识,事实上,掌握基本的前端技能(HTML/CSS/JS)足以写出你想要的页面效果了。
我是一名前端工程师,你可以查阅一下我写的这篇文章《前端开发程序员的Linux技术学习之路》,当然,如果你想要学习Linux运维的话,可以考虑先入门Linux的知识,这本《Linux就该这么学》就是一本很不错的书籍。
祝你在学习路上逐渐成长和克服迷茫。
⑶ wab前端和linux运维,我该学习哪个哪个前景和工资高点
前端不是你想做就能做的 纯代码的前端没有前途,除非你美工做的好,设计有天赋,能够组哟一些框架类的东西。
前期来看,前端工资是高的,但是这个到了中期以后,基本不会再上涨了,运维是开始很少,越到后面越吃香。
前端要学的东西少,入门简单,但是要脱颖而出做到精细就比较困难了,要做大牛级别,那更是要钻研的很深刻,更多的需要一些天赋上的悟性。
运维学的东西从来都是很多的。不管是通信也好,电气也好,计算机也是。要涉及大量的基础知识,根据自己岗位的职责,还需要有争对性的提升某一类知识的深度。普遍加班,工作时间不稳定。
仅供参考,要根据自己的兴趣来,不要盲从,计算机行业,从来就不是奔着工资,这个理由就可以做好的。真心不要看工资,因为对于刚转行的你,那些都是空的,你都不知道你能不能坚持到那个时候,所以现在开始,尽可能多接触一点岗位,发现一个真正适合自己生活习惯,学习能力和兴趣志向的岗位才是王道。
⑷ 做前端和运维哪个有前途
做前端和运维哪个有前途?不知道选择那个专业,可以直接分析一下,分析一下前景,工资待遇以及自己兴趣所在。接下来分析一下:
web前端开发:
1.Web前端人才需求还会持续增加
据有关数据统计,未来五年,我国信息化人才总需求量高达1500万—2000万人。其中“网络工程”“UI设计”“web前端”等人才的缺口最为突出,所以web前端的市场需求还是很大的。更有甚者,目前不仅大型互联网公司拟相继成立了专属的web 前端部门,中小型公司和创业公司也急需专业的web前端工程师。
2.web前端薪酬工资仍会上涨。
随着互联网的发展前端技术也不断的在更新,市场需求越来越大。工资待遇水平呈上涨趋势。
3.web前端就业方向广。
现在主要涉及到的领域有很多比如网站,网页,H5游戏开发,小程序,等等。具体的就业方向还可以按公司的技术需求来区分,侧重点各有不同,就业行业随着互联网的发展,已经变得越来越广泛了。
4.web前端未来发展前途大好。
随着5g时代的到来互联网出现了自动驾驶 车联网,物联网、人工智能、智能家具等领域需要前端开发人员,有需求就有市场。
运维:
总的来说,运维的薪水普遍比开发人员略低一点。这是因为上手运维工作比开发门槛略低,市场上有很多运维人员处于“会搭建服务”的状态。这种门槛确实比会“粘贴复制”代码,还要低一点。
但是随着你个人能力的提升,金ˇ字塔效应一样会很明显。各大公司都需要技艺高超的运维人员,开出的价格并不会比你同龄的开发人员明显低。
总结:个人建议选前端开发不管是未来还是现在,都有一个很好的发展,但是最主要还是技术能力强。想好选择前端开发,就要做好长久奋战打算。前端开发和其他的编程是不一样的,它更新换代比较快。今年流行的衣服或许明年就不流行了,所以要不断的学习新的技术,才可以在这个行业站的更久,位置更高。
但是也要看自己对那哥方向感兴趣,对那个方向感兴趣就选择那个。“自知者不如好之者,好之者不如乐之者。”
⑸ java,php,云计算运维,web前端,学哪个比较好
现在已经是互联网已经转为大数据时代了,个人感觉面向大数据的云计算比其他的吃香,但是只要自己好好学习,无论哪个都可以找到不错的工作的
如果现在想当程序员你可以学习一些更新技术:
1 大数据
2 人工智能
3 物联网
它们目前还比较缺人,且待遇优厚
⑹ 各位大神 女生做前端,测试,运维 哪个比较
你好,现在前端市场不是特别火了,现在市场上对初级前端开发工程师的要求不多,很多公司招中高级的前端开发工程师。如果你对前端非常感兴趣,你在自学了解这个课程时候觉得非常简单,那你可以选择前端开发。测试的话,基本上难度不大,也不需要你写太多的代码。运维的话,也是需要些代码的。运维必须你要懂数据库这一块。其实这3个专业当中,我觉得最适合女生是测试专业,难度不大,女生做的也不少。
⑺ linux运维工程师与web前端相比较哪个更好
这是两个方向,如果能兼顾 就更牛了。
选web前段吧。
⑻ web 研发部, 移动开发部, 运维部,那个好点呀
最好还是看一下自己擅长哪个方向吧,毕竟这三个部门负责的方向都是不一样的。
像研发部主要都是搞项目研发的,但是这个项目的研发方向也是不定向的,主要还是看部门会分配到怎么样的项目,而且通常都是新项目慢慢发掘出现,这也意味着准备方案前期会比较长,整个工作周期也会比较长。
移动开发部应该是电子通讯终端那个方向的而,如果比较熟练或者熟悉电子通讯那个方面的行业,或者是网络前端的研发方向比较熟悉,那么这个会比较适合知晓这方面专业的人。
而运维部通常有可能和后台运营以以及维持运转,也只就是后台的维持运作有关,这方面的处理有可能是和后台运营对接比较多。
建议选择的话最好是自己擅长什么就选择什么,这样会比较得心应手。
⑼ 做linux运维跟web前端哪个比较好一点,计科专业,抛开兴趣的话
我就是计科的,做了几年的前端,觉得女孩还挺合适的,不会很辛苦,而且有时候做网页动画也有点挑战,有点乐趣,而且前端一直短缺,可以考虑